Everyday hustle in Nigeria be challenging , and many people dey try to earn a living. But the influx of copyright, also known as counterfeits, dey turn this hustle into a struggle.

These products range from gadgets and clothing to cosmetics. Some Nigerians wey don buy these copyright, dem later realize say dem no dey work properly. This na why many people dey demand a fix.

The government dey try to combat this problem by enforcing stricter laws against the sale of copyright. But, the business still dey prosper underground.

Many factors contribute to the prevalence of copyright in Nigeria, including:

  • High demand for cheap products
  • Weak law enforcement
  • Corruption

This na a multifaceted issue wey need a holistic approach to solve. We need to work together as citizens to combat this menace.

Nigerian Market Deception: Beware of Counterfeits

Bros and Sis, let me tell you something about the Naija market. It's a place where you can find anything your heart desires, from authentic goods to some straight-up fraudulent items. You need to be very careful when you are shopping here because there are lots of people trying to scam innocent customers. Make sure you always check the quality of a product before you buy it. Don't just trust what the seller tells you, do your own due diligence. And if something seems too good to be true, it probably is.

  • Always compare prices for the same product.
  • Inspect the branding of the goods.
  • If possible, demand to see a receipt or warranty from the seller.
